    Aggregate planning is one of the most important activities of operations management for a competitive supply chain. Aggregate planning balances supply and demand during the planning time horizon. Aggregate planning in a food industry with perishable goods characteristics is a common problem. Mostly, studies on aggregate planning are only concerned with single product and single-phase production processes. This paper proposes a two-stage aggregate planning model that can be applied in the food industry with perishable goods characteristics. The two stages of the production process consist of processing raw materials into intermediate products and processing intermediate products into final products by implementing postponement or intermediate product storage. Processing of raw materials into intermediate materials is expected to solve the problem of material deterioration rate. The aggregate planning model uses a mathematical model approach and is solved by using Goal Programming. Based on the results of model verification using hypothetical data, the aggregate planning model can be applied to the food industry which implements a two-stage production system.     FORMULASI CAIRAN PEMBERSIH AIR CONDITIONER (AC) BERBASIS METIL ESTER SULFONAT (MES)

    Get PDF
    Cleaning is one of the air conditioner (AC) treatments that should be done within a certain period to maintain its function. The AC cleaning process cannot separate from the use of cleaning fluid as one of the main ingredients. This study aimed to obtain the most efficient formulation of AC cleaner fluid from Methyl Ester Sulfonate (MES) with Hydrogen Fluoride (HF) in improving performance and seeing the effect of sonication on the effectiveness of detergent in resulting the AC cleaner. The AC cleaner formulation used the two factors Completely Randomized Design method, namely MES deposition (10%, 20%, 30%) and HF concentration (1%, 2%, 3%). The combination stage was based on parameters of density, viscosity, surface testing, wetting, and pH. From these testers, the three best treatments were M10H3 (MES 10% + HF 3%), M20H3 (MES 20% + HF 3%), M30H3 (MES 30% + HF 3%). Three samples were tested for detergency so that the best treatment was M30H3 (MES 30% + HF 3%). Sonication treatment was able to improve the properties of the resulting AC cleaner, with the density value of 1.0193 g/cm3 to 1,0001 g/cm3 , surface tension from 23.676 dyne/cm to 20.765 dyne/cm, contact angle from 32.37oto 20.5 o, pH from 2.44 to 2.9, and particle size from 10.85 μm to 158.27 nm. The post-state sample had a higher detergency power than before sonication that can increase cleaning ability by as much as 70%. However, the resulting formulation did not have a higher detergency level than commercial AC cleaner brand X.Keywords: AC Cleaner, air conditioner, HF, MES, sonicatio

    STRATEGI PENGEMBANGAN SUMBER DAYA MANUSIA YANG BERDAYA SAING DAN BERKELANJUTAN PADA AGROINDUSTRI TEBU: TINJAUAN LITERATUR DAN AGENDA PENELITIAN MENDATANG

    Get PDF
    The purpose of this paper was to analyze the sugarcane agroindustry situational, human resources, and regulations to obtain new research on sugarcane agroindustry. The method carried out was by collecting 50 articles from 2002 - 2020 from indexed journals, theses, books. Articles were divided into three parts, namely sugarcane agroindustry with 14 articles, human resources with 19 articles and 17 regulations. In the VUCA era, we need skills, systems thinking skills, predictive abilities, and the ability to change quickly which is coupled with the Covid-19 pandemic conditions that accelerate the need for digitalization in the VUCA era. The results of the analysis show that the problem of lagging human resources in Eastern Indonesia is caused by a mismatch between labour users\u27 needs and the availability of skills. The non-oil and gas processing industry sector provide the largest contribution to employment, one of which is the sugarcane industry. The sugarcane agroindustry problem was the large gap between supply of 2.17 million tons and demand of 6.6 million tons of which the shortfall of 4.43 million tons is met through imports of raw crystal sugar. The government\u27s efforts to suppress imports by encouraging the private sector to establish new sugar factories outside Java and the expansion of existing sugar factories are accompanied by the preparation of human resources, so that a strategy for developing human resources that is competitive and able to adapt to the environment is needed.Keywords: eastern Indonesia, human resources, situational analysis, sugar cane agro-industry, strateg

    PENGEMBANGAN ATRIBUT PRODUK KERIPIK SINGKONG MENGGUNAKAN METODE VALUE ENGINEERING BERBASIS CUSTOMER ORIENTED

    Get PDF
    The development of the home industry and the challenges during the pandemic have prompted the need for innovation, especially in the aspect of the marketing mix. The development of this aspect will make MSME products able to compete in the modern retail industry. This effort was implemented in Mr. Baihaqi\u27s cassava chips business, which according to preliminary research needs to develop product aspects, especially on packaging and labels. This study aims to determine recommendations for the development of cassava chips using the value engineering method based on customer oriented. This study aimed to determine recommendations for the development of cassava chips using the value engineering method based on customer oriented. The stages carried out in this study were the information stage by filling out an online questionnaire which is known to be prioritized marketing mix to be developed, namely in terms of packaging and adding labels. The creative stage was carried out by analyzing the morphology of packaging and labels. The analysis stage was carried out by filling out a pairwise comparison questionnaire and analyzed using expert choice 11 software. Development stage with a business feasibility analysis based on Cost of Goods Sold (COGS) and Break Even Point (BEP). The last stage was the recommendation stage for product development presentation. The results showed that the priority of product development was standing pouch plastic packaging using top-bottom labels with a value of 0.160 and COGS of Rp. 4,063.97, BEP of production of Rp. 404,232.27 and BEP units of 57.75 packs.     PREDIKSI PASOKAN BAWANG MERAH MENDUKUNG DESAIN PENGEMBANGAN AGROINDUSTRI DI PROVINSI ACEH

    Get PDF
    One of the focus of agricultural commodities development is shallot. It was contributed on national and regional inflation. Therefore, is not a national centra prodcution of shallot, Aceh Province has shallot centra productio, namely at Pidie, Aceh Tengah and Aceh Besar district. As we know that the main character agricultural product was seasonal, thus sholud be effectivally managed of its.  The objectives of this research were to obtain prodcution shallot pattern and to design a agroindustrial model which suitable with shallot characteristic production. The technique used Auto Regresive Moving Average (ARIMA), the data is used time-series (monthly) for 6 month, whereas option design model and product used Analitical Hierarcy Process (AHP). The result of study show that a model of ARIMA (p,d,q) was (0,0,1) with mean square 20,682,669. Meanwhile, the prediction of production t+1=6,662 qiuntal. The option of model design was micro-agroindustrial with a weight (0,59), small-agroindustrial (025). Whereas the main product was pasta (0,41), shallot (0,26) and shallot-cuted (0,19)   Key words: Agroindustrial, Shallot, ARIMA and AH
